(拍大腿)哎哟喂,上周帮朋友搞了个快递小程序,那叫一个折腾!今天咱们就来唠唠这个让无数新手头秃的快递微信下单源码,保准让你少走三年弯路!
一、源码这玩意儿到底是啥?
说实话,第一次听说"源码"这词儿,我还以为是快递单上的条形码呢!后来才知道,这玩意儿就跟做菜用的食谱差不多——告诉你小程序怎么做出来的。网页3提过,快递代取系统的源码里藏着用户注册、订单管理这些核心功能,就像菜谱里的油盐酱醋(网页3)。
这里有个坑得注意:不是所有源码都能直接用的!见过最离谱的源码,数据库字段名全用拼音缩写,看得人想报警。所以说啊,选源码得跟挑对象似的,得看家底干不干净(网页8)!
二、选源码的三大黄金法则
1. 接口要像高速公路
快递接口可是核心中的核心!网页6说过,微信官方的物流助手API能同时对接十几家快递公司,就跟在高速路口设收费站似的。这里教你们看源码必查三点:
- 有没有预装微信支付接口(网页4重点)
- 能不能自动获取电子面单(网页7实测)
- 物流轨迹更新及不及时(网页2的血泪教训)
2. 数据库别整成盘丝洞
见过最乱的数据库,用户表和订单表搅和在一起,跟毛线团似的。按网页3的规范,至少得拆成五张表:
- 用户表(存微信openid)
- 快递信息表(单号、地址)
- 订单表(状态、时间)
- 支付表(金额、方式)
- 评价表(打分、吐槽)
3. 前端要像导航软件
用户可不是技术宅!网页4说过,好的界面要让大妈都会用。记住这三个指标:
- 下单流程不超过3步(网页5最佳实践)
- 字体最小14px(老年人友好)
- 按钮间距30px起(防误触)
三、开发中的五大天坑
上周给客户调试,发现个要命的bug——用户手机号居然明文存储!吓得我赶紧按网页2的方案加了双层加密。这里给新手提个醒:
坑位名称 | 常见症状 | 救命方案 |
---|---|---|
支付接口掉链子 | 用户付了钱订单没生成 | 用网页6的微信支付沙盒测试 |
物流信息延迟 | 快递都签收了还显示运输中 | 接入网页7的实时轨迹接口 |
并发量上不去 | 双十一直接宕机 | 按网页8方案上云服务器 |
安全漏洞 | 用户信息被爬虫扒光 | 学网页3的token验证机制 |
兼容性问题 | 苹果能用安卓闪退 | 按网页4的多机型测试方案 |
(突然想到)对了!网页5提过个小技巧:把快递公司的logo做成雪碧图,能减少80%的HTTP请求,加载速度嗖嗖的!
四、自问自答时间
Q:自己写源码还是买现成的?
A:摸着良心说,新手直接买成熟源码最划算!网页8的案例显示,自己开发至少要3个月,买现成的两周就能上线。不过要小心盗版源码,去年有客户买的源码居然带挖矿代码!
Q:微信审核总不过咋办?
A:八成是支付流程没做沙盒测试!按网页6的教程,先在测试环境跑通全流程。记住三个必过关:
- 隐私协议要醒目(网页4强调)
- 客服入口别隐藏(网页7实测)
- 诱导分享全删光(血泪教训)
Q:用户量暴涨怎么办?
A:提前做好这三手准备:
- 数据库读写分离(网页8方案)
- 接入CDN加速(网页5推荐)
- 备用服务器待命(网页2的应急预案)
小编观点
折腾了这么多快递小程序项目,说句掏心窝的话:现在做这行就跟开饭店似的——源码是厨房设备,接口是进货渠道,运营才是真本事!最近发现个邪门规律:带智能推荐功能的快递小程序复购率能涨30%(网页3数据)。要是让我重新选,肯定直接上微信物流助手+现成源码组合拳,省下的时间搞运营不香吗?记住,好源码自己会说话,关键得让用户觉得"哎这玩意儿真方便"!